Output 74210d7a573172a8bb80a30fb8ba4b38d18b509b6231bd5da6d233bae29d21f2:0

value
8446000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c900ea37147f3320d717344e6d674efed8e28331 OP_EQUAL
address
MSDy9ZEuTTg4Mi8p4NReb1abwKfx5aEb3N
transaction
74210d7a573172a8bb80a30fb8ba4b38d18b509b6231bd5da6d233bae29d21f2
spent
true